Is Gutter Cleaning Important?
Gutter cleaning, though a seemingly periodic endeavor, is incredibly essential in upholding the structural and practical integrity of a home. Gutters, primarily produced to channel rainwater far from the roofing and foundation, play an integral role, specifically when one thinks of the total volume of rain that can be discharged on a large rooftop. Nonetheless, when debris starts to accumulate, these gutters can't completely play their protective role.
West Virginia University states: “Your rain gutters serve a purpose—they protect your house, windows, doors and foundation by collecting the rainwater and leading it through it downspouts to prevent water damage and flooding.”
What Happens If Rain Gutters Are Not Kept Clean?
Gutters should be cleaned a minimum of two times a year to ensure optimal performance and durability.
American Society of Home Inspectors states: "Like all other components and systems in your home, gutters require regular maintenance to ensure they are working properly."
In colder climates, the water trapped in gutters can freeze. This results in the formation of ice dams, which can damage the gutters and even lead to leaks inside the property by pushing ice under roof shingles.
Moreover, the added weight of debris and trapped water can cause gutters to sag or break away from their attachments. Neglecting to keep your gutters clean can lead to structural, aesthetic, and health issues, emphasizing the importance of regular maintenance.
How Frequently Should Gutters Be Cleaned?
West Virginia University offers the following advice: “Always remember that rain gutters should be cleaned at least twice a year.”
Periodic maintenance is crucial to defend against possible complications that ensue from stopped up guttering and downspouts.
Living in an area with heavy rainfall might warrant more recurring cleaning. As debris, like leaves and twigs, piles up, it constrains the water flow, risking damage to the property. Seasonal changes further stress the requirement for this routine maintenance.
The autumn season, with its shedding of leaves, frequently involves an in depth cleaning. In the same manner, the consequences of spring introduces seed pods and blossoms that can block gutters.

While the normal recommendation is a biannual cleaning, unique conditions of your environment may well call for more frequent attention. Engaging skilled gutter cleaning services can provide individualized recommendations based on the distinct challenges of your place. Essentially, while cleaning two times a year is a good rule of thumb, you should always be attuned to the particular requirements of your home and environments.
Guidelines For Cleaning Frequency
Residential Property:
If you don’t have any trees around the property, an annual cleaning should be sufficient. If you have several trees, you will need to have them cleaned at least 2 times per year. If you have a lot of trees, you would need them cleaned no less than four times per year.
Industrial Or Commercial Property:
Most industrial and commercial properties are fine with an annual cleaning, but care needs to be taken if there are trees around the property.
Apartment Or Condo:
Our general suggestion for most apartments and condos is to have the gutters cleaned on a semi-annual basis. On average, these types of properties contain more trees than industrial or commercial properties but generally less than residential properties.

How Much Does Gutter Cleaning Cost In Oneida?
Size of Your Property
The cost of gutter cleaning services routinely changes depending on the length of gutters found on a property. Obviously, larger homes with more comprehensive gutter systems may incur higher fees because of the increased amount of work and time taken.
Complexity of the Guttering System
A more complicated gutter system, distinguished by a range of bends, numerous levels, or special designs, will influence the expense. The degree of difficulty soars with complexity, calling for specialized tools or methods for comprehensive cleaning.
Accessibility
The ease of access of your gutters plays a crucial role in ascertaining the cost. Gutters that are difficult to reach, possibly due to landscaping or architectural barriers, can make the undertaking more tough, influencing the total rate of the service.
Height of the Building
The height of a property can specifically influence the expense. Gutter cleaning services for taller buildings typically come at a premium, predominantly because of the added dangers and equipment necessitated to reach higher elevations.
Condition of the Gutters and Downspouts
Gutters in a state of significant neglect, overflowing with blockages and sediment, may well increase the expense. The main reason being, they require more thorough cleaning and potentially small repair work.
Time Of Year
The time of the year that you have your gutters cleaned out can affect the price of the cleaning due to several factors, including staffing, weather patterns, urgency required, etc.

Important Facts About Rain Gutters and Gutter Cleaning
What Do Rain Gutters Do?
Rain gutters gather water from the roofing, directing it away from the foundation to prevent conceivable damage. Their principal purpose is to safeguard the home's structural integrity by ensuring water flows out efficiently, defending against buildup and the adverse consequences of mold and mildew. Furthermore, by retaining a clean channel for water, gutters help prevent debris like leaves, branches, twigs, and dirt from settling on roofing shingles.
Theconstructor.org states: “A rain gutter system channels water out and away from the building’s foundation.”
In the US, up to .044 gallons (200 milliliters) of rain can fall per minute per square foot of roof area. On a 2000-square-foot roof, that’s 88 gallons (400 liters) of rainwater per minute!
How Do Gutters and Downspouts Get Clogged?
Gutters and downspouts eventually become blocked mostly due to the build-up of debris such as leaves, branches, and dirt. Over time, these materials gather and curb the progress of water, creating backups. Bugs and rodents can likewise contribute to obstructions, building nests and leaving behind waste. Furthermore, in cooler latitudes, snow and ice can be an element; as they melt and refreeze, they can obstruct the regular water flow.
The causes of blocked gutters and downspouts are diverse, however recognizing them is really important to guaranteeing proper home care.
What are the Consequences of Clogged Gutters?
Water Damage: Cascading rainwater can ruin the home's siding, fascia, and foundation.
Roof Damage: Pooled water can rot wood roof structures and damage roof shingles.
Basement Flooding: Incorrect water drainage can generate water build-up around the foundation, triggering basements to flood.
Insect Infestations: Stagnant water draws in bugs like mosquitoes, rodents, and wasps.
Landscape Erosion: Overflows can wear down gardens and ruin plants.
Mold and Mildew Growth: Moist environments help with the growth of mold and mildew, which can be harmful to health.
Gutter Damage: The weight of trapped debris can trigger gutters to droop, pull away, or even crack.
Ice Dams: In colder environments, trapped water can freeze and form ice dams that even further impair water flow.
Decreased Property Value: Structural and aesthetic damages due to blocked gutters can lower the home's resale value.
Addressing gutter stoppages promptly is vital to prevent these adverse outcomes on your home.
How Can You Tell Your Gutters are Blocked?
- Overflowing Water: When it rains, rainwater overflows the sides of the gutters as opposed to flowing through downspouts.
- Sagging Gutters: Too much weight from trapped debris can cause gutters to sag or bend.
- Stagnant Water Pools: Places of standing water or moist spots near the foundation of your property.
- Birds or Pests: Frequent activity of birds, pests, or insects near your gutters may be an indicator of nesting or standing water.
- Visible Debris: Overhanging leaves, branches, or other debris sticking out from the top of gutters.
- Plants Growing: Tiny plants or weeds sprouting from the gutters.
- Drips or Sounds: The sound of dropping or trickling water from gutters when it's not raining.
- Stains on Siding: Watermarks, mold, or mildew on the exterior siding of your residence, specifically below the gutters.
- Eroded Landscape: Gully development or destroyed landscaping directly below the gutters.
- Peeling Paint: Peeling or bubbling paint on your home near the gutters because of constant water exposure.
A routine cleaning schedule can avoid a number of the complications associated with blocked gutters.
Also, periodic assessments at the time of cleanings can identify potential issues early on, allowing for timely interventions. A proactive approach to gutter care not only extends the life-span of the gutters but also protects the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of the entire property.
Do Gutter Guards Help In Reducing Blockages?
A gutter guard is a protective mesh or cover fashioned to stop leaves, debris, and insects from getting in and blocking the gutters. However, while the concept sounds worthwhile, there are flaws to take into account. First, the initial cost of installation can be excessive for a lot of homeowners. Secondly, a significant number of products on the market do not perform as promoted, enabling debris to accumulate or causing water to overshoot the gutters..
Lerablog.org, in their article“The Pros and Cons of Gutter Guards”, states: “If you have a steep roof or valleys the rainwater will likely overshoot the gutter altogether.”
7 Essential reasons to clean your gutters
1 . Prevents debris from causing blockages
Routine gutter cleaning helps deal with blockages, ensuring sufficient water flow and minimizing the risk of gutter damage or overflow that can bring about damage to your house.
2. Protects your home’s foundation
By keeping gutters clean and working efficiently, a gutter cleaning service provider helps protect against rainwater from overflowing and pooling around your house's foundation, which can bring on structural damage and high-priced repairs.

3. Reduces the risk of pests
Clogged gutters can establish a breeding place for pests such as rodents, birds, and mosquitoes. Rain gutter cleaning services help to get rid of these potential nesting areas and keep your residence pest-free.
4. Extends the lifespan of gutters
Regular gutter servicing by a expert service helps identify and repair minor issues before they end up being substantial problems, ultimately extending the life span of your gutters.
5. Increase value of your property
Clean and well-kept gutters add to the overall curb appeal of your home, which can be especially vital if you prepare to sell your property.
6. Ensures Safety
Gutter cleaning can be a unsafe undertaking, particularly for homeowners who are not experienced in operating at heights. Working with a professional gutter cleaning company makes sure the project is done carefully and properly.
7. Reduces Water Damage Risk
Properly functioning gutters are required for directing water far from your home's roof, walls, and foundation. Routine gutter cleaning services help prevent water damage and the capacity for mold and mildew growth.
